Singapore has recently achieved the status of having the most powerful passport in the world, according to the latest passport rankings. This distinction highlights the passport's extensive visa-free or visa-on-arrival access to numerous countries, making it the most advantageous for global travel.

The rankings reflect Singapore's strong diplomatic relations and the effectiveness of its international agreements. In contrast, India's passport has shown significant improvement, climbing two spots in the global rankings.

This rise indicates a positive trend in India's passport strength, likely due to enhanced bilateral agreements and improved visa policies with other nations. The increased ranking is a testament to the country's growing global presence and diplomatic efforts.

The latest rankings emphasize the importance of visa-free travel capabilities in evaluating passport strength. While Singapore leads with its broad access, India's gradual ascent underscores its progress and potential in the global travel arena. This development is also seen as an encouragement for further diplomatic and economic engagements to boost the country's international mobility.

Overall, the changes in passport rankings reflect broader geopolitical dynamics and the evolving nature of global travel. Singapore's achievement and India's progress are indicative of the shifting landscape of international mobility and the ongoing efforts by countries to enhance their global standing.
